Introduction to Forensic Evidence in Crimes Against Humanity Cases

Forensic evidence plays a pivotal role in cases involving crimes against humanity by providing scientific and objective data to establish accountability. It encompasses a wide range of investigative methods used to analyze physical evidence from crime scenes, victims, or suspects. This type of evidence helps build a factual basis for prosecuting complex and often long-standing atrocities.

In crimes against humanity cases, forensic evidence can include human remains analysis, DNA profiling, fingerprinting, ballistics, and evidence of mass graves or illicit destruction. Its meticulous collection and examination are crucial for accurate documentation and verification of events, especially amid the chaos of conflict zones.

The use of forensic evidence has significantly enhanced the capacity of international courts and tribunals to deliver justice. It transforms subjective testimonies into reliable, scientific proof, aiding in the identification of perpetrators and establishing the scale of the crimes committed.

Preservation and Collection of Evidence in Conflict Zones

Preservation and collection of evidence in conflict zones pose significant challenges for forensic investigations linked to crimes against humanity. In these environments, ongoing violence, instability, and lack of infrastructure often hinder the proper gathering of forensic data. Ensuring the integrity of evidence requires meticulous protocols to prevent contamination, tampering, or loss.

Forensic teams must adapt to limited resources, often working under dangerous conditions. Rapid response is critical to secure sites immediately after incidents, such as mass graves or sites of executions. Proper documentation, including photographs and detailed logs, is essential to maintain evidence authenticity.

International standards emphasize that evidence should be preserved in secure, accessible locations, with chain-of-custody maintained rigorously. Use of portable forensic tools and protocols tailored for conflict settings helps mitigate the difficulties of evidence collection. Ultimately, effective preservation and collection are foundational to ensuring the evidentiary value in crimes against humanity cases.

Technological Advancements Enhancing Forensic Investigations

Recent technological advancements have significantly enhanced forensic investigations in crimes against humanity cases. High-resolution digital imaging and 3D scanning enable detailed documentation of crime scenes without physical disturbance, preserving critical evidence in its original state.

Next-generation DNA analysis techniques, such as massively parallel sequencing, allow for more precise identification of individuals, even from degraded or limited samples, thereby strengthening the reliability of forensic evidence. Cyberforensics has also advanced, facilitating investigations into digital data that may reveal communication networks or locations linked to perpetrators.

Automated forensic databases and international data sharing platforms improve collaboration across borders, ensuring rapid access to relevant information and reducing investigative delays. While these innovations greatly impact the field, challenges remain in implementing and standardizing their use in conflict zones, where conditions are often adverse. Overall, these technological advancements are transforming forensic evidence collection, making it more accurate, efficient, and integral to crimes against humanity cases.

Case Studies Demonstrating Forensic Evidence in Crimes Against Humanity

Several notable cases demonstrate the pivotal role of forensic evidence in crimes against humanity.

For example, the International Criminal Tribunal for the former Yugoslavia (ICTY) utilized forensic evidence to identify mass graves and victims linked to ethnic cleansing during the 1990s Balkan conflicts.

Another significant instance involves the Rwandan genocide, where forensic investigations helped recover and identify thousands of victims, establishing responsibility for genocidal acts.

Key methods in these cases included DNA analysis, ballistic forensics, and excavations of mass graves, which collectively provided irrefutable evidence used in prosecuting perpetrators.

Two essential points in these case studies are:

  1. Forensic evidence confirmed the identities of victims and linked suspects to specific crimes.
  2. It played a decisive role in securing convictions in international tribunals.
